Abstract
A system for sensing particulate matter receives a first plurality of electronic signals from a photodetector over a period of time, the first plurality of electronic signals associated with a first plurality of particles, wherein each of the first plurality of electronic signals has a respective amplitude, sorts the first plurality of electronic signals into a plurality of amplitude levels, determines a respective quantity of signals associated with each amplitude level, determine an average summation of the first plurality of electronic signals, performs a calibration using the average summation, receives a second plurality of electronic signals from the photodetector over a period of time subsequent to the calibration, the second plurality of electronic signals associated with a second plurality of particles, and determines a mass concentration of the second plurality of particles based on the second plurality of electronic signals.
